Transaction 1e406934b001d41ec14a7a03f425c15c67583fe3e6ae1622c437159e9bac656a
1 Input
1 Output
-
1e406934b001d41ec14a7a03f425c15c67583fe3e6ae1622c437159e9bac656a:0
- value
- 320585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26aaf023d2ea8cb743638627b9c7dc89d1b75f00 OP_EQUAL
- address
- 35DUNpLfYG4ju36QfewgrbaMqjW1FR3QQG